Bruce was soon well enough for the 90-mile ride to Billings, Mont. There X rays located the bullet - in Bruce's left knee. Evidently the bullet had hit a rib, lost its momentum, entered the pulmonary vein carrying oxygenated blood from the lungs to the heart's upper left chamber. Car ried along with the blood, the slug went through the mitral valve into the left ventricle and up through the aortic valve. It turned downward at the aorta's arch in the upper chest, and traveled through the femoral artery until this became...

Long Trail Unwinding. A natural athlete, it still took him a while and some frustrations to get where he is. As a Cleveland Indians rookie in 1957, he fractured a rib in a collision at second base, hit a sorry .235 in 116 games. Traded the next season to the Kansas City Athletics, Maris doubled his home run output to 28, batted-in 80 runs-but still fell far short of promise. Last year in Kansas City, he led the league in batting at one point despite being sidelined for an appendectomy. But he ended the season with a disappointing...
